Strap TensioningCorrect tensioning is one of the most important aspects of securing loads with material handling straps. Straps should be tightened to the right level to prevent shifting, but not too tight as to cause damage to the load. Over-tightening can stress both the strap and the object, while under-tightening can lead to load instability. Load DistributionEvenly distributing the weight of the load is critical for ensuring secure transport. By balancing the load and applying straps in multiple areas, the strain is more evenly spread, preventing any one strap from taking on too much tension. This helps ensure the load remains stable throughout the handling process. Strap SelectionChoosing the correct type of material handling strap is essential for the safety of the load. Different loads require different strap strengths, materials, and configurations. For example, heavier loads may need straps with higher weight ratings or specialized materials to prevent breakage or wear. Inspection and MaintenanceRegular inspection of straps for wear and tear ensures they remain effective in securing loads. Straps that show signs of fraying, cracking, or damage should be replaced immediately to avoid failure during transport. Additionally, cleaning and properly storing straps helps prolong their lifespan and effectiveness. Safety ProtocolsFollowing proper safety protocols is essential for securing loads and protecting workers. These protocols include using straps designed for specific loads, checking for any issues before use, and ensuring workers are trained in proper securing techniques. By implementing these best practices, companies can reduce the risk of accidents and improve overall safety.
